Linux基本目錄結構介紹:
-
bin
:英文全稱binary,含義是二進制。該目錄中存儲的都是一些二進制文件,文件都是可以別運行的。 -
dev
:該目錄中主要存放的是外接設備,例如:盤,其他的光盤等。在其中的外界設備是不能直接被使用的,需要掛載(類似Windows 下的分配盤符) -
etc
:該目錄主要存儲一些配置文件。 -
home
:表示“家”,表示除了root用戶以外其他用戶的家目錄,類似與Windows下的User/用戶目錄。 -
proc
:全稱process,表示進程,該目錄中存儲的是Linux運行時候的進程 -
root
:該目錄是root用戶自己的家目錄 -
sbin
:全稱:super binary,該目錄也是存儲一些可以被執行的二進制文件,但是必須得有super權限的用戶才能執行。 -
tmp
:表示“臨時”的,當系統運行時候產生的臨時文件會在這個目錄存儲着。 -
usr
:存放的是自己安裝的軟件。類似與Windows下的Program Files. -
var
:存放的程序/系統的日誌文件的目錄。 -
mnt
:當外接設備需要掛載的時候,就需要掛載到mnt目錄下。
-
pwd 指令
:(Print working directory, 打印當前工作目錄) -
cd指令
: (Change directory,改變目錄)
作用:用於切換當前的工作目錄得
例子:當前在usr/local下,需要使用相對路徑切換目錄到home目錄下得Linux123用戶家目錄中去。
cd …/…/home/linux123 -
cd~
:直接切換到當前用戶到家目錄 -
4.
mkdir 指令
指令:mkdir (make directory 創建目錄)
語法:mkdir 路徑 (路徑,可以是文件夾名稱也可以是包含名稱得一個完整路徑)
注意:ls列出得結果顏色說明,其中藍色得名稱表示文件夾,黑色得表示文件,綠色得其權限爲擁有所有權限。
語法2:mkdir-p 路徑
當一次創建多層不存在得目錄得時候。添加-p參數,否則會報錯
語法3:mkdir 路徑1 路徑2 路徑3 (表示一次性創建多個目錄) -
5.
touch 指令
作用:創建文件
語法:touch 文件路徑(路徑可以是直接得文件名也可以是路徑) -
6.
cp指令
(Copy,複製)
作用:複製文件/文件夾到指定得位置
語法;cp被複製得文檔路徑 文檔被複制到的路徑